Wiring System

ANSWER :

Is a form of electrical circuit.



Electrical circuit

ANSWER :

Is comprised of an energy source, energy transfer medium and a load.



Energy Transfer Medium

ANSWER :

copper wire, fiber optic cables and air in the case of radiated energy



Load

ANSWER :

receives the transferred energy such as resistors, lights, speakers, motors, etc.



EMF (electromotive force)

ANSWER :

The force that moves electrical energy.



Current or Current Flow

ANSWER :




1

, The movement of electrons through a circuit that is caused by the electromotive force or
voltage applied to the circuit.



Inductance (L)

ANSWER :

Unit is the henry. It is the property of a circuit that causes an opposition to any change of
current within the circuit. As electrons flow, a magnetic field is produced. The magnetic force
induces a change in voltage.



Grounding

ANSWER :

assures transmission of electrical signals without interference from electromagnetic radia-
tion from other transmission lines and equipment. This interference, called crosstalk, can
happen from adjacent lines, motors, PCs, lights and other devices.



Grounding electrode

ANSWER :

Connection to the electrode should be less than 1 ft below the surface of the solid and the
electrode should extend at least 10 ft below ground.



Ground Loop

ANSWER :

Causes a current to flow in the low resistance of the shield resulting in electromagnetic
waves that are picked up as noise through the wire.



66 block

ANSWER :

A punchdown block that terminates 22 to 26 AWG solid copper wire. The 25 pair standard
non split 66 block contains 50 rows.




2

, 110 block

ANSWER :

To terminate on-premises wiring in structured cabling. IDC or Insulation displacement con-
tact connector is used to terminate the twisted pair. The 110 allows for a much higher den-
sity of terminations, less crosstalk and higher bandwidth data.



UF

ANSWER :

Cable can be buried into the ground. Not approved for commercial use in NM. 340.10



Balun

ANSWER :

A means of matching an unbalanced antenna or transmission line to a balanced transmis-
sion line or antenna (Usually have a transformer in them)



Bus Topology

ANSWER :

All nodes are connected to a single shared communication line



Ring Topology

ANSWER :

Topology where the computers are connected on a loop or ring.



Star Topology

ANSWER :

A topology with one central node that has each computer or network device attached to
the central node. All data first goes into the central node and then is sent out to its destina-
tion.
